About SAERTEX

Family-owned company SAERTEX®, with sales of approx. €350m, is the global market leader in the production of multiaxial fabrics (non crimp fabrics) and core materials for manufacturing composite materials. Customers in the wind, aerospace, automotive, sports and shipbuilding industries rely on composites that gain in terms of lightness, stability and corrosion resistance thanks to SAERTEX® reinforcement materials made of glass, carbon and aramid fibers. SAERTEX® multiCom® is a leader in the trenchless pipe rehabilitation sector – in the areas of both waste water and potable water applications. With a total of 1,400 employees and 14 manufacturing facilities on five continents – together with an active sales and distribution network in over 50 countries – the SAERTEX® Group is a global player.
